Steamed Rice Cake Recipe

Steamed Rice Cake is a delicious and healthy snack that is popular in many Asian countries. It is also known as 'Chwee Kueh' in Singapore, 'Putu Mayam' in Malaysia, and 'Idli' in India. This dish is made from rice flour and water, then steamed until it becomes soft and fluffy. It is usually served with savory toppings such as soy sauce, chili sauce, and fried shallots.

Cook Time

Cooking time for this dish is about 20-25 minutes.

Ingredients

  • 2 cups of rice flour
  • 2 1/2 cups of water
  • 1 teaspoon of salt
  • 1 teaspoon of sugar
  • 1 tablespoon of vegetable oil
  • Toppings of your choice (soy sauce, chili sauce, fried shallots)

Equipment

  • Steamer
  • Mixing bowl
  • Measuring cups
  • Measuring spoons
  • Whisk

Method

  1. In a mixing bowl, combine the rice flour, water, salt, sugar, and vegetable oil.
  2. Whisk the mixture until it is smooth and free of lumps.
  3. Let the mixture rest for about 10 minutes.
  4. Grease the steamer with a little vegetable oil.
  5. Pour the mixture into the greased steamer.
  6. Steam the mixture for about 20-25 minutes or until it is cooked through.
  7. Remove the steamer from the heat and let it cool for a few minutes.
  8. Use a spoon or spatula to remove the steamed rice cake from the steamer.
  9. Serve the steamed rice cake with your desired toppings.
  10. Enjoy your delicious and healthy snack!

Notes

  • You can add grated coconut to the mixture for a more flavorful taste.
  • Steaming time may vary depending on the size of your steamer and the thickness of the rice cake.
